数据工程中的任务调度实践

数据工程中的任务调度实践

💡 原文中文,约3300字,阅读约需8分钟。
📝

内容提要

数据工程领域面临复杂系统和任务调度挑战。混沌工程通过注入故障提高系统健壮性。日志驱动的任务调度解决重复调度、补数据、任务依赖等问题,提高稳定性和可靠性。混沌工程实验揭示了常规任务调度不够健壮,日志驱动提升系统稳定性和数据工程实践丰富性。

🎯

关键要点

  • 数据工程领域面临复杂系统和任务调度的挑战。
  • 混沌工程通过注入故障提高系统的健壮性。
  • 日志驱动的任务调度解决了重复调度、补数据和任务依赖等问题。
  • 混沌工程实验揭示常规任务调度的脆弱性。
  • 高可用性与程序逻辑的健壮性是两个不同的概念。
  • 幂等性并不足以保证系统的稳定性。
  • 反脆弱的任务调度应能处理失败情况并保证数据完整性。
  • 日志驱动的任务调度可以解耦不同调度系统的实现。
  • 日志驱动的好处包括解决重复调度、灵活的任务依赖配置和统一的运维操作。
  • 通过混沌工程的实验,发现日志驱动可以提高ETL任务的稳定性和丰富数据工程实践。
➡️

继续阅读